Weather-Responsive Watering



Weather-responsive watering systems make use of smart climate sensing units to optimize watering schedules based on present environmental problems. These systems include rainfall hold-up functionality, which stops unneeded watering throughout damp climate, and seasonal modifications that customize water usage to varying climate patterns. Therefore, they improve water performance and advertise much healthier landscapes.


Smart Weather Condition Sensors



Smart weather sensing units have reinvented the effectiveness of modern-day watering systems by changing watering routines based on real-time environmental data. These sensing units monitor variables such as temperature, moisture, wind rate, and solar radiation, enabling systems to respond dynamically to altering weather. By integrating this information, clever sensors can enhance water use, decreasing waste and guaranteeing that landscapes obtain the appropriate amount of dampness. This innovation not only preserves water however likewise promotes healthier plant growth by stopping overwatering or underwatering. Additionally, the automation offered by smart weather condition sensing units boosts user comfort, as landscapers and homeowners can count on exact watering routines without hands-on treatment. In general, these advancements stand for a substantial improvement in lasting irrigation methods.

Soil Wetness Sensors



Dirt wetness sensors play a crucial duty in contemporary watering systems, supplying real-time information that enhances water efficiency. These devices measure the volumetric water web content in the soil, enabling specific evaluations of moisture degrees. By incorporating soil moisture sensing units right into watering systems, users can stay clear of overwatering or underwatering, eventually promoting healthier plant development and preserving water resources.The sensors transmit information to controllers, which can adjust watering routines based upon present soil problems. This data-driven strategy reduces water waste and guarantees that plants get the very best quantity of wetness. In addition, dirt dampness sensing units can be valuable in different agricultural settings, from home gardens to large farms. The release of these sensing units adds to lasting methods by supporting liable water usage and lowering ecological effect. On the whole, the consolidation of soil wetness sensors notes a considerable improvement in accomplishing effective irrigation systems.
